Career path

Career Role Description
Privacy Incident Manager (UK) Leads incident response, ensuring data protection and regulatory compliance. High demand for experience in GDPR and UK data protection legislation.
Data Protection Officer (DPO) (UK) Advises on data protection compliance, conducts audits, and manages privacy risks. Crucial role in organisations handling sensitive data, especially with increasing fines for non-compliance.
Cybersecurity Analyst - Privacy Focus (UK) Focuses on the privacy aspects of cybersecurity incidents, assisting in threat mitigation and incident response related to data breaches. Strong analytical and investigative skills are essential.
Privacy Consultant (UK) Provides expert advice to organisations on data protection strategies, compliance, and incident management. Deep understanding of various data privacy regulations is key.
